Get in Touch** The Dodge repair market for the Ireton, IA area is characterized by a need for residents to travel to larger neighboring cities for specialized service. There are no dedicated Dodge or SRT performance shops within Ireton itself. The local market consists of one or two general repair shops capable of handling basic maintenance but not the complex, specialized needs of HEMI, SRT, Hellcat, or AWD systems. The competitive landscape is therefore centered in Sioux City and Sioux Center. The quality of service is generally high, with several shops boasting excellent reputations and long tenures. For high-performance work, M & M Auto & Performance is the standout specialist, while Zylstra Automotive and Graham Auto & Tire offer exceptional general and OEM-level expertise. Pricing is competitive for the Midwest, with general labor rates typically ranging from $110-$150 per hour. Performance tuning and engine-specific work commands a premium, often requiring an initial diagnostic fee. Customers are advised to book appointments well in advance, especially with the performance-focused shops, due to high demand and specialized nature of the work.

For Ireton-area Dodges, we frequently address suspension components worn from gravel roads and potholes, along with brake system issues. Winter driving also leads to battery failures and problems with 4x4 systems, especially in Ram trucks and older Durangos, due to corrosion and heavy use.
Seek a shop with certified technicians, specifically those with Chrysler CAP or ASE credentials. For genuine parts, your closest Mopar parts dealers are in larger nearby towns like Sioux Center or Le Mars, but a trusted local shop in Ireton will source reliable aftermarket or OEM parts for a durable repair suited to our driving conditions.
Labor rates in Ireton are often more competitive than in metropolitan areas like Sioux City. However, parts costs are generally consistent, though availability for specific Dodge models may cause slight delays, potentially impacting the overall timeline rather than the price significantly.
Seek immediate service if you notice signs of cooling system failure, like overheating, especially before summer or during harvest season when dust and heat strain engines. Also, address any 4WD warning lights before winter to ensure safe traction on icy Sioux County roads.
Consider your truck's usage; frequent hauling for farming or livestock near Ireton increases wear on transmissions and diesel particulate filters (in EcoDiesel models). Schedule service around the agricultural seasons to avoid busy shop periods during planting and harvest.
